Job Description: Serves as the primary point of contact for the local community during the planning and construction of Toronto Transit Commission projects. Acts as the lead in facilitating community relations during the design/pre-construction and construction phases, working collaboratively as a bridge between stakeholders and TTC construction teams. Job Responsibilities: Proactively identify and resolve potential construction related problems or issues of concern, that may arise within the community as a result of both pending and on-site construction activities Develop outreach and communication plans to inform the public of construction activities and their impacts and mitigation measures, including through facilitating public information events, conducting site visits, preparing presentations, newsletters, brochures, notices, social media and web content, etc. for distribution Liaise with property owners/managers, residents, tenants, site staff, contractors and local agencies to manage on-site construction issues relating to property access, pedestrian safety, restoration, parking, signage, noise, dust/dirt, etc. Prepare supporting documentation, and research/obtain additional information to ensure all public concerns and issues are addressed accurately and promptly with construction personnel as required Promotes a respectful work and service environment that supports diversity, inclusion, and is free from harassment and discrimination.
